Title: Karl Pichler: Innovator in Transparent Conductors and Organic Devices

Introduction

Karl Pichler is an esteemed inventor based in Santa Clara, CA, known for his significant contributions to the fields of electronics and materials science. With an impressive portfolio of 43 patents, Pichler has made notable advancements in the integration of advanced materials into electronic devices.

Latest Patents

Among his latest inventions are groundbreaking methods to incorporate silver nanowire-based transparent conductors in electronic devices. These innovations include optical stacks designed to remain stable when exposed to light, achieved by incorporating light stabilizers and oxygen barriers. Another notable patent encompasses an organic solar module along with its fabrication method. This invention presents a method of forming an organic device where a hybrid cathode layer is precisely aligned with a substrate. This hybrid cathode features a combination of conductive nanowires and electron-transport materials, culminating in the creation of a photoactive layer and a hybrid anode layer, ultimately contributing to the enhanced efficiency of organic electronic devices.

Career Highlights

Throughout his career, Karl Pichler has worked with prominent companies, including Cambridge Display Technology Limited and Osram Opto Semiconductors GmbH. His experiences in these organizations have likely played a critical role in nurturing his innovative mindset and engineering talents.

Collaborations

Pichler has collaborated with influential figures in the industry, including Richard Henry Friend and Martin R Roscheisen. These partnerships have facilitated the exchange of ideas and technology, further propelling advancements in the fields of nanotechnology and organic electronics.
